Sherilyn "Sheri" Ruth (Wicks) Baker, age 59, a Fort Gibson, OK resident for the last 30 years, was born on Sunday, November 9, 1958, to Forrest Thrift and Kathryn Lorine (Claye) Wicks, in Oklahoma City, OK. She was the second of five siblings. Sheri passed away on Monday, October 15, 2018 at her home in Fort Gibson, OK. She moved to many places during her childhood due to her father's calling as a Baptist Minister. She graduated from Talihina High School in 1977 and then attended Southeastern University.

She married Wayne Bradford Baker on Sunday, April 19th, 1981 in Whitesboro, OK. They had 37 wonderful years together before her passing. She devoted her heart and soul to raising their four children. As they grew older, she went back to school and graduated with her Bachelor's Degree from Northeastern State University before securing a job at DHS. Employed by the Department of Human Services for 18 years, her current position was a Social Services Supervisor for Cherokee County in Tahlequah, OK.

Sheri was a woman of many talents and accomplishments, but those pale in comparison to her amazing heart. Sheri had the kindest soul, and was always willing to lend an ear to her family and friends. She loved the summer when she could enjoy the lake, fishing, and the smell of freshly cut grass. She was an avid music lover, a cinnamon roll connoisseur, had a fondness for scented soaps, an amazing sense of humor and could figure out a way to fix almost any problem. However, her greatest life accomplishment was her love and devotion to her children and grandchildren. It is an undisputed fact that Sheri was the greatest mother and nan any child could ask for, and the void she leaves behind in all their hearts can never be filled. Sheri, we'll only miss you when we're breathing.

Sheri is survived by her husband, Wayne Bradford Baker of the home in Fort Gibson, OK; children, Bridgett, Waylon, Whitney, Dakota and his wife, Donna; five beloved grandchildren, Allie, Corbin, Aubrie, Hudson, and Liliana; mother, Kathryn Wicks; siblings, Beth Calvin, David Wicks, Deborah Roberts, and Paul Wicks; along with nieces, nephews, other relatives and many dear, beloved friends.

Sheri is preceded in death by her father, Forrest Thrift Wicks Jr.
